The Design Of A New Type Of Respiratory Protective Product And The Cover Body's Mould

Product USES headband connection valve with the new head bring collocation is used rather than direct structure design, structure design will be connected in mask body. We choose the best material of the cover molding materials by comparing the body performance of different rubber.On the subject of respiratory protection mask forming process was studied, and finally we decided to use liquid silicone rubber injection molding, this plan shorten molding cycle, improve the production efficiency and reduce labor intensity. Mold design using UG Mold Wizard module in the Settings, from start to finish the overall structure shrinkage mould, this paper expatiates the mould. Using UG design, there are many module which can be chosed is standard, so it save a lot directly with the time, more calculated modern social efficiency requirements.Using injection molding methods will shorten the molding cycle, increase productivity and reduce the relative cost, as well as help improve the utilization of raw materials, which would make the use of respiratory protection products more popular.
